Broker Review Red Flags: Spotting the Deception

Navigating the brokerage landscape can be challenging. Pinpointing red flags early on is crucial to escaping potential scams and choosing a reputable broker.

Here are some common warning signs to look an eye on:

* **Too-good-to-be-true promises:** If a broker guarantees unrealistic returns or promotes unusually high profits, it's a major red flag. Be skeptical of any claims that seem too perfect to be true.

* **Lack of transparency:** A trustworthy broker will be honest about their fees, policies, and performance.

Stay clear from brokers who are vague or evasive when answering your questions.

* **Pressure tactics:** Legitimate brokers won't pressure you into making rapid decisions. Take your time to research your options and compare different brokers before committing.

* **Unlicensed or unregistered brokers:** Ensure the broker you select is properly licensed and registered with relevant financial authorities in your jurisdiction.

By paying attention to these red flags, you can traverse the brokerage world with certainty. Remember, doing your due diligence is essential for preserving your financial well-being.

Capital Scam Alert: Is Your Broker Legit?

Be cautious when trusting the world of investments. Sadly, illegitimate brokers are preying on unsuspecting people seeking to boost their wealth.

It's crucial to confirm the authenticity of any broker before committing your assets. Here are some tips to help you identify a genuine broker:

* Explore the broker's history thoroughly. Check with regulatory bodies like the SEC for registration.

* Review online feedback from other clients. Be wary of overly glowing reviews that seem contrived.

* Comprehend the broker's commissions and platform layout. Avoid brokers with unexplained fees or a confusing platform.

* Converse with the broker directly to seek explanation about their offerings. Pay attention to their availability.

Remember, protecting your capital well-being starts with being an informed and vigilant investor. Don't let con artists take advantage of your confidence.
